The Proud Family: EPs Louder and Prouder Discuss Biggest Lessons BTS Learned Ahead of Disney+ Revival Season 2

Those who grew up in the 2000s Disney Channel lineup were treated to television specials that are still popular today. American Dragon: Jake Long, Lilo and Stitch: The Series AND Kim possible (whose stars “cannot escape” their impact) are prime examples of beloved House of Mouse hits. Of course, another series that has managed to stand the test of time is the proud familywhich was revived for Disney+ in 2022. The show, subtitled stronger and prouder, stood out in its first season by building on its predecessor and adding new elements to the canon. Despite this success, the executive producers learned some valuable behind-the-scenes lessons before starting work on season two.

The Proud Family: Stronger and Prouder is led by co-creators Bruce W. Smith and Ralph Farquhar, who also created the OG show. Seasoned veterans of television and animation, the two have a strong creative understanding of the beloved universe they have created. However, even at this stage, there’s still room to master new skills and strategies. I had the pleasure of speaking with the enterprising executive producers about their creative process ahead of the Season 2 premiere. When asked about the biggest lessons they’ve learned between seasons 1 and 2, Smith pointed to their handling of the massive roster of characters:

Well, we knew we expanded the cast, so the expanded cast leads to trying to make more space for these new characters to, you know, exist in the story. So what you witnessed in the top ten [episodes was] we’re laying the groundwork for these new characters that are, you know, going to permeate this world now. And what we’ve learned from that is that we want to go the extra mile and serve all the new characters in this Proud Family universe. But really, what we’ve learned is that we can tell any kind of story, you know? There is no topic we get away from, why [of] the tone that we set and how the audience believes in these characters and believes who these characters are.

stronger and prouder significantly expanded the cast by adding new characters like siblings Maya and KG Leibowitz-Jenkins and Kareem Abdul-Jabbar Brown, Penny Proud’s new boyfriend. Additionally, characters from the original series, such as Michael Collins, play a bigger role in the revival. It was a smart creative move by the producers, as it allows for the creation of additional worlds, which effectively feed into the narrative. And as Bruce W. Smith noted, the show is now free to create more varied narratives about the Proud Ones and those in their orbit. (And naturally, the proud family The wide range of famous guest stars is included in this equation.)

Effectively balancing characters and stories is an important lesson, but the creators found another important one, suggested by Ralph Farquhar. Interestingly, this is something he and his collaborators learned before the sequel series was greenlit. Farquhar explained that the creative team discovered a key factor regarding the audience:

Yeah, I think one of the big things was the first time, what we found was that the adults were watching the show as much as the kids. And it was on purpose, but it really caught us off guard, because we were on the Disney Channel. So it was hard to imagine that, you know, grown men and women were sitting there watching Disney Channel by themselves, and apparently they were. After [the] the second time we really put in, knowing that, and even with the fact that now the kids from 2001 to 2005 were now adults, we knew we were going to have a great… In fact most of our audience are adults. So without gloves, so to speak, we got a PG rating. I mean, I know it’s PG, but it’s a big difference from before, in terms of what we could handle and how we dealt with it. That’s the most important thing that we’ve learned, I think, in terms of storytelling, and I think it really shows in the stories that you’ve seen so far and will see. [in] Season 2.
